I didn’t know these Japanese vending machines had a name. They are called gachapon or gacha (sometimes spelled with an S instead of a C) and this place is the king of them all apparently.

This is called a Mizu Shingen Mochi and it’s special because it looks like a giant drop of water! Moves like one too!

Probably one of my favorite GoPro videos to date. All about the crazy car culture in Japan.